This applies to Windows 7 and above and MXWendler version 4.2 and above

Problem:

When there is no audio in or out, it is generally related to a non-existing audio recording device under windows 7:

Test:

Is there a default audio recording device?
If not, create a default recording device

Solution:

Open audio settings, recording devices
Right click 'Show disabled devices'
'Enable' the device 'Stereo Mix'
'Set as default' the device 'Stereo Mix'
